A method and an apparatus for generating a secret key for encrypted communication using a synchronized neural network, which includes: generating initial codewords based on a bit string of weight values of the synchronized neural network and transmitting a first partial codeword of the initial codewords to a device of another party; receiving a second partial codeword generated by the device of the other party and combining final codewords based on the second partial codeword received from the device of the party and the bit string of the weight values; performing an error correction on the combined final codewords and transmitting first restoration success information according to the error correction to the device of the other party; and receiving second restoration success information from the device of the other party and generating the secret key based on the restoration success information of the device of the other party, are provided.

Provided are a method and a system for an additive homomorphic encryption scheme with operation error detection functionality. A plaintext is obtained by decrypting a ciphertext encrypted based on a homomorphic encryption technique and subjected to an operation and lower setting bits corresponding to additional secret information included in a final private-key are extracted as plaintext information from the acquired plaintext. An operation error check is performed on the remaining bits other than the lower setting bits in the acquired plaintext.

A multi-user searchable encryption system includes a key generation center to issue a private secret key to a user and trace information regarding a user who has generated an index, and a user terminal device to generate an index for searching for a database using the private secret key. The multi-user searchable encryption system includes a database (DB) server that verifies the index generated by the user terminal device and searches for corresponding data to the verified index.
